@Sweetleaf If you have any records like police reports, protection orders, letter from therapist of necessity to seal records, etc. you should specify you have records to support the request on the form, you should bring them to court with you and offer them to the judge if needed at the appropriate time. Judges very much like it when the people before them are organized, and have what they need when it is asked for. In a name change matter that little bit goes a long way when it comes to the judges first impression of the character of the petitioner before them.

Judges for the most part are pretty accommodating unless you irritate them, word of advice from someone who has prosecuted a couple of civil case of my own, don't talk out of place (unprompted), wait for judge to ask questions, answer as the judge asks them. Judges like to be in control of the dialog, and get irritated when the person before them is trying to direct the dialog. Believe it or not that dynamic can wreck your changes a lot.

I did my own name change petition and order, and at the time had a past arrest (over 10 years ago at the time), and I still got my order, honesty goes a long way, the model format at the time had a line stating petitioner has had no prior arrest, my petition replaced that line to say I have not been in trouble for over 10 years. my name change was not for protection purposes, and at the time had a higher chance of non approval than it would in a case of protection.
